Year 4 have been focussing on the properties of 2D shapes for our autumn term maths learning. We have been looking at triangles, quadrilaterals, polygons and other non-polygons.
A good starting point was to come up with a definition for each shape type. The pupils were asked to look at the number of sides, the corners and to think about straight or curved lines.
A sorting exercise then took place. The pupils cut out a variety of shapes. These were then stuck in our books in the corresponding shape area.
